Patent number: 10799931Abstract: A formed material manufacturing method according to present invention includes the steps of forming a convex formed portion by performing at least one forming process on a surface treated metal plate, and performing ironing on the formed portion using an ironing mold after forming the formed portion. The ironing mold includes a punch that is inserted into the formed portion, and a die having a pushing hole into which the formed portion is pushed together with the punch. An inner peripheral surface of the pushing hole extends non-parallel to an outer peripheral surface of the punch, and the inner peripheral surface is provided with a clearance that corresponds to an uneven plate thickness distribution, in the pushing direction, of the formed portion prior to the ironing relative to the outer peripheral surface to ensure that an amount of ironing applied to the formed portion remains constant in the pushing direction.Type: GrantFiled: April 11, 2019Date of Patent: October 13, 2020Assignee: NIPPON STEEL NISSHIN CO., LTD.Inventors: Naofumi Nakamura, Yudai Yamamoto, Jun Kurobe

Patent number: 10790480Abstract: A lithium-ion secondary-battery case that allows bonding without weld spatter and has high strength against external force acting on the battery case, and a method for manufacturing the lithium-ion secondary-battery case are provided. Specifically, an austenitic stainless steel foil is used for a cup component (2), and a two-phase stainless steel having an austenite transformation start temperature AC1 in a temperature increase process at 650° C. to 950° C. and an austenite and ferrite two-phase temperature range of 880° C. and higher, is used for a cover component (3), and the diffusion bonding is proceeded while accompanied by grain boundary movement upon transformation of the two-phase steel from a ferrite phase into an austenite phase within a heating temperature range of 880° C. to 1080° C.Type: GrantFiled: August 25, 2014Date of Patent: September 29, 2020Assignee: NISSHIN STEEL CO., LTD.Inventors: Katsunari Norita, Norimasa Miura, Jun Kurobe

Patent number: 10207306Abstract: The present invention suppresses deterioration in the corrosion resistance of a worked portion resulting from working cracks in a Zn-based plated layer (3) in a workpiece (2) formed into a predetermined shape by performing plastic working on a Zn-based plated steel sheet (1) coated with a Zn-containing metal as a raw material. That is, plastic working is performed on a raw material that is a Zn-based plated steel sheet (1) to obtain a workpiece (2) having a predetermined shape, and thereafter, pressurization processing is performed on a worked portion in a sheet thickness direction to deform the plated metal, thus decreasing the width of working cracks in the plated metal. Accordingly, it is possible to reduce the deterioration in the corrosion resistance of the worked portion of the Zn-based plated workpiece.Type: GrantFiled: August 22, 2014Date of Patent: February 19, 2019Assignee: NISSHIN STEEL CO., LTD.Inventors: Hirokazu Sasaki, Jun Kurobe

Patent number: 9821355Abstract: A method of manufacturing a rectangular tube having a stepped portion includes: forming V-shaped grooves on a rectangular tube at surfaces of an end thereof in a direction parallel to a longitudinal direction thereof; and pressing each of the surfaces having the V-shaped grooves formed thereon with a rotating roll from outside to inside, whereby the end of the rectangular tube is radially reduced.Type: GrantFiled: March 28, 2014Date of Patent: November 21, 2017Assignee: NISSHIN STEEL CO., LTD.Inventors: Ryuji Tanoue, Hirokazu Sasaki, Naofumi Nakamura, Jun Kurobe

Patent number: 9669440Abstract: A formed material is manufactured by performing forming including at least one drawing-out process and at least one drawing process performed after the drawing-out process. A punch 31 used in the drawing-out process is formed to be wider on a rear end side than on a tip end side. By pushing a raw material metal plate into a pushing hole 30a together with the punch 31, ironing is performed on a region of the raw material metal plate corresponding to a flange portion.Type: GrantFiled: May 14, 2014Date of Patent: June 6, 2017Assignee: Nisshin Steel Co., Ltd.Inventors: Naofumi Nakamura, Yudai Yamamoto, Jun Kurobe

Patent number: 8635898Abstract: Provided is a spinning method of reducing a diameter of a work piece pipe body with processing rollers disposed on an outer surface of the work piece pipe body, the processing rollers being configured to be relatively revolved around the work piece pipe body, wherein, when the processing rollers are axially reciprocated while being moved in a radius direction of the work piece pipe body, wherein the diameter reducing process with the processing rollers is performed under a state in which a wound body formed of an elastic sheet-like material is inserted as a core body into the inside of a portion of the work piece pipe body to be subjected to the diameter reducing processing.Type: GrantFiled: January 5, 2010Date of Patent: January 28, 2014Assignee: Nisshin Steel Co., Ltd.Inventors: Shinobu Karino, Akihiro Ando, Jun Kurobe

Patent number: 8471169Abstract: Provided is an electrode (1) which has a double structure including Cu or a Cu alloy as an electrode body (2) and a core material (3) made of W, Mo, a W-based alloy, or a Mo-based alloy embedded in a surface of the electrode body (2) which is abutted against a material to be welded, the core material (3) being formed by using W, Mo, the W-based alloy, or the Mo-based alloy which is in the form of a fibrous structure extended by sintering, swaging, and annealing in an electrode axis direction, the fibrous structure having a horizontal cross-sectional average particle diameter of 50 ?m or more and an aspect ratio of 1.5 or more. The electrode (1) can be used as an inexpensive electrode obtained by suppressing particle dropping/attrition and defects in electrodes for spot welding, in which heat and pressure are applied repeatedly, stably enhancing durability.Type: GrantFiled: June 6, 2007Date of Patent: June 25, 2013Assignees: Nippon Tungsten Co., Ltd., Nisshin Steel Co., Ltd.Inventors: Shingo Mukae, Kenji Okamura, Shuichi Teramoto, Jun Kurobe, Hiroshi Asada, Shouji Inoue, Shigeo Matsubara
